However, as good as that start has been, they are already in \u201cmust-win\u201d territory in one particular aspect. The Rockets are 0-1 so far in the NBA Cup. They play the Portland Trail Blazers for their second game in the event on Friday night. Will the Rockets avoid virtually guaranteed elimination by falling to 0-2?<\/p>\n<h2>Rockets Face Must-Win NBA Cup Bout<\/h2>\n<h3>The Rockets&#8217; NBA Cup<\/h3>\n<p>The Emirates NBA Cup, originally conceived as the mid-season tournament, is in its third year. Early group games are scattered amid the regular scheduling, taking place on Fridays.<\/p>\n<p>Last season, the NBA Cup was something of a coming-out party for the Rockets. They finally ended their <a href=\"https:\/\/lastwordonsports.com\/basketball\/2024\/12\/12\/nobody-beats-alperen-sengun-16-times-in-a-row\/\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_self\">fifteen-game losing streak<\/a> against the Warriors in the quarterfinals. This year, the Rockets have bigger goals in mind than a run at the NBA Cup. Still, an early exit would be something of an ill omen, even if it would align with <a href=\"https:\/\/lastwordonsports.com\/basketball\/2025\/10\/19\/houston-rockets-2025-26-predictions-five-just-fun\/\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_self\">some people&#8217;s predictions<\/a>.<\/p>\n<p>The Rockets are in the Western Conference\u2019s Group C. The competition in the group is fierce. The other members are the Golden State Warriors, San Antonio Spurs, Denver Nuggets, and Portland Trail Blazers. Only one team per group is guaranteed to progress to later rounds. The Blazers may seem like the runt of the litter, but it\u2019s the Rockets and the Warriors that remain winless.<\/p>\n<p>The Rockets lost their <a href=\"https:\/\/www.nba.com\/game\/hou-vs-sas-0022500032\/box-score?watch=&amp;utm_campaign=unknown&amp;utm_source=rockets&amp;utm_medium=web\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">first NBA Cup game<\/a> of 2025-26 to <a href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/w\/wembavi01.html\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Victor Wembanyama<\/a>&#8216;s 8-3 Spurs. That&#8217;s a loss that will still sit with them, especially star center <a href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/s\/sengual01.html\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Alperen Sengun<\/a>. Mandatory Credit: Paul Rutherford-Imagn Images<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<h3>Friday Night&#8217;s Matchup<\/h3>\n<p>In facing the Blazers on Friday, the Rockets have a good chance to secure their first NBA Cup win. However, the Blazers are not pushovers by any means. On the season, with head coach <a  href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/b\/billuch01.html\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Chauncy Billups<\/a> under Federal indictment, Portland is 6-5 under interim head coach <a  href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/s\/splitti01.html\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Tiago Splitter<\/a>. <a href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/h\/holidjr01.html\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Jrue Holiday<\/a> is having a bounce-back year after dealing with injuries in Boston. He&#8217;s putting up 17.0 points, 5.4 rebounds, 8.5 assists, and 1.5 steals per game. That\u2019s all with the veteran leadership that comes from being an NBA champion, renowned two-way player, and vaunted professional.<\/p>\n<p>Among the Blazers&#8217; youth movement, <a href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/a\/avdijde01.html\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Deni Avdija<\/a> is an early favorite for the Most Improved Player award. He\u2019s averaging 26.1 points, 6.3 rebounds, and 4.6 assists. That\u2019s with solidly efficient all-around shooting splits of 48.9% from the field, 38.2% from three, and 85.4% from the free-throw line. The Blazers have size in seven-foot-two <a href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/c\/clingdo01.html\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Donovan Clingan<\/a> and explosive scoring potential in the 2024-25 <a href=\"https:\/\/www.youtube.com\/watch?v=QpuLSitSlg8\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">dunk of the year<\/a> winner, <a href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/s\/sharpsh01.html\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Shaedon Sharpe<\/a>.<\/p>\n<p>Nevertheless, the Rockets have a potent mix of youth and experience of their own. <a href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/d\/duranke01.html\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Kevin Durant<\/a> is fitting in seamlessly as expected. Moreover, the Rockets are seeing leaps all across the roster. Sengun is taking the point center concept to new extremes. <a href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/t\/thompam01.html\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Amen Thompson<\/a> is gaining invaluable playmaking reps of his own. <a href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/s\/sheppre01.html\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Reed Sheppard<\/a> is <a href=\"https:\/\/lastwordonsports.com\/basketball\/2025\/11\/13\/reed-sheppard-nba-record-rockets-wizards\/\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_self\">adding historic milestones<\/a> to his growing resume as a <a href=\"https:\/\/lastwordonsports.com\/basketball\/2025\/11\/09\/rockets-sheppard-finding-his-groove\/\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_self\">bona fide NBA marksman<\/a>.<\/p>\n<p><iframe loading=\"lazy\" title=\"Reed Sheppard (21 points) Highlights vs. Washington Wizards\" width=\"640\" height=\"360\" src=\"https:\/\/www.youtube.com\/embed\/7jZrD_8CArQ?feature=oembed\" frameborder=\"0\" allow=\"accelerometer; autoplay; clipboard-write; encrypted-media; gyroscope; picture-in-picture; web-share\" referrerpolicy=\"strict-origin-when-cross-origin\" allowfullscreen><\/iframe><\/p>\n<h3>The Last Word<\/h3>\n<p>The Rockets are and should be firm favorites in the matchup. However, that can be dangerous in its own right. This Blazers team has already caught out a few opponents who were expecting an easy night. Officially, the Rockets may approach the game with the same intensity they&#8217;d have for any other. Indeed, the NBA Cup schedule is such an enigma to most of the NBA community that that might not be so far from the truth. Luckily for Houston fans, the Rockets have not been short of intensity in 2025-26. The Rockets play like every trip down the floor is a must-win possession. NBA Cup or no, it&#8217;s must-watch basketball, and with the Blazers out from under Billups&#8217; shadow, all bets are definitely off.<\/p>\n<p>Featured Image: Erik Williams-Imagn Images<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>The Houston Rockets are off to a fantastic start in 2025-26.
